How much do advanced process control engineer jobs pay per year?

As of Jun 25, 2026, the average yearly pay for advanced process control engineer in Texas is $92,009.00, according to ZipRecruiter salary data. Most workers in this role earn between $70,300.00 and $108,500.00 per year, depending on experience, location, and employer.

What are the key skills and qualifications needed to thrive as an Advanced Process Control Engineer, and why are they important?

To thrive as an Advanced Process Control Engineer, you need a solid background in chemical or process engineering, strong analytical skills, and typically a bachelor's or master's degree in a related field. Proficiency with distributed control systems (DCS), process simulation software like AspenTech, and experience with control algorithms or programming languages such as MATLAB or Python are commonly required. Strong problem-solving abilities, effective communication, and teamwork are crucial soft skills for collaborating with cross-functional teams and implementing solutions. These skills ensure safe, efficient, and optimized plant operations, directly impacting production quality and profitability.

What is the difference between Advanced Process Control Engineer vs Process Control Engineer?

AspectAdvanced Process Control EngineerProcess Control Engineer
CredentialsBachelor's or Master's in Engineering, certifications in control systemsBachelor's in Engineering, some certifications may apply
Work EnvironmentIndustrial plants, manufacturing facilities, chemical and oil & gas industriesSimilar environments, often overlapping in manufacturing and processing plants
ResponsibilitiesDesigning and implementing advanced control strategies, optimizing processesMonitoring and maintaining control systems, troubleshooting

The Advanced Process Control Engineer specializes in developing sophisticated control strategies to optimize industrial processes, often working on complex systems. In contrast, the Process Control Engineer focuses on maintaining and troubleshooting existing control systems. Both roles share similar environments and required skills, but the advanced engineer typically handles more complex control algorithms and process optimization projects.

What are Advanced Process Control Engineers?

Advanced Process Control (APC) Engineers are specialized professionals who design, implement, and maintain advanced control systems in industrial processes, such as those used in chemical, oil & gas, or manufacturing plants. Their goal is to optimize production efficiency, improve product quality, and minimize costs by utilizing advanced algorithms, software, and control strategies. They work with various technologies, such as model predictive control, real-time optimization, and data analytics, to enhance process operations. APC Engineers often collaborate with process engineers, operators, and IT specialists to ensure the successful integration of control solutions. Their expertise contributes significantly to the safe, efficient, and sustainable operation of industrial facilities.

Job description

TITLE: Process Control Engineer I

POSITION OBJECTIVE: Optimizes the production of current products through process improvements.  Develops, coordinates, and manages process and equipment engineering projects to support introduction of new products, processes and equipment as well as machine and process upgrades.  Four manufacturing processes:  blown film extrusion, in-line printing, bag forming (conversion), and product packaging (cartoning) comprise the manufacturing area of responsibility. Provides support in a variety of management areas to ensure compliance with environmental regulatory standards, OSHA safety standards, American Sanitation Institute standards, housekeeping standards, Good Manufacturing Practices (GMP’s), and CTPAT program standards for security.

QUALIFICATIONS:

  • Bachelor’s Degree or equivalent required, Engineering preferred
  • Experience with process engineering, equipment design and product engineering
  • Experience with blown film
  • Experience with project management and implementation
  • Must possess effective verbal and written communication skills
  • Working knowledge of general manufacturing and business principles
  • Willing and capable of domestic and international travel
  • Experience with plastic bag conversion, preferred
  • Experience with product packaging operations, preferred
  • Ensure consistent, dependable attendance and demonstrate a willingness to accommodate non-standard work hours as necessary.
  • Capable of effectively managing job-related stress and fostering productive workplace interactions.

JOB RESPONSIBILITIES:

  • Design and manage records of process improvements.
  • Manage and improve cost associated with the manufacturing processes. Focus should be improving all aspects of cost including yield, formulation, up time, and product quality.
  • Interact with sales, marketing, manufacturing, and maintenance to determine and develop product designs, product specifications, manufacturing methods, feasibility studies, and timeline for project completion.
  • Develop/write capital requests for project equipment or materials working with various vendors for best value, lowest cost.
  • Direct completion of active manufacturing and process related projects with particular emphasis on project objectives and achieving time & capital budget constraints.
  • Responsible for development, evaluation and implementation of new or improved manufacturing methods and/or processes. 
  • Determine methods and/or upgrades that increase production capacity and machine efficiency thereby, reducing manufacturing costs.
  • Verify via reports that capital projects perform as projected.
  • Support manufacturing of current products by investigating and explaining the causes of scrap.
  • Interact with Technical Specialist(s) in activities that foster continuous improvement of current processes and, completion of active process and manufacturing improvement projects.
  • Actively participate as a member of the Safety Committee. 
  • Provide resource information, participate in accident investigations, advise course of action to correct unsafe conditions, provide engineered designs as necessary to ensure compliance with OSHA regulations.
  • Provide project and process improvement status updates as required.
  • Perform other duties as requested by management.
